RETORQUE HEAD BOLTS
After 50 hours of operation, retorque the head bolts for
this engine to 4.0 kgim (29 foot-pounds).
The torque sequence is A, B, C, D, E (star pattern).

SERVICE AIR CLEANER
CAUTION: Never run this unit without the
complete air cleaner system installed on the
engine. This could result in premature wear
to the engine.
Your engine wilt not run properly and may be damaged if
you run it using a dirty air cleaner.
Clean or replace the air cleaner paper filter once every 25
hours of operation or once a year, whichever comes first.
Clean or replace more often if operating under dusty or
dirty conditions. Clean foam precleaner every 25 hours of
operation or sooner under dusty conditions.
To clean or replace foam precteaner:
Remove air cleaner cover, then foam pre-fitter.

Wash precteaner in soapy water. Squeeze pre-filter
dry in clean cloth (DO NOT TWIST),
Clean air cleaner cover before installing it.
clean or replace paper air filter:
Remove air cleaner cover; then remove foam pre-fitter
(service if necessary) and remove paper filter.
Clean paper filter by tapping it gently on a solid sur-
face. If the filter is too dirty, replace it with a new one.
Dispose of the old filter properly.
Clean air cleaner cover then insert precleaner into
cover, Next insert new.paper filter into cover to hold
precfeaner in place and assemble all of them to the
base of the air cleaner,
CLEAN SPARK ARRESTOR SCREEN
The engine exhaust muffler has a spark arrestor screen.
Inspect and clean the screen every 100 hours of opera-
tion or once each year, whichever comes first.
i_k, WARNING: Let the muffler cool before
working on it. Contact with a hot muffler or
engine can cause severe burns,
NOTE: If you use your pressure washer on any forest-
covered, brush-covered or grass-covered unimproved
land, it must have a spark arrestor. The spark arrestor
must be maintained in good condition by the owner/oper-
ator,
Clean and inspect the spark arrestor as follows:
° To remove the muffler guard from the muffler, remove
the four screws that connect the guard to the muffler
bracket,

Remove four screws that attach the spark arrestor
screen.
Inspect screen and replace if torn, perforated or other-
wise damaged. DO NOT USE a defective screen, tf
screen is not damaged, clean it with commercial solvent.
Reattach the screen and the muffler guard,
